Subject: [PATCH] Documentation/vm/page_owner.rst: fix function usage information for -f option

A previous linux-next based patch
d7e9705bb715fc3deb16bfd5976d9d50f8d2aa67
(tools/vm/page_owner_sort.c: fix the instructions for use)
stated that the description for the "-f" option should be
"Filter out the information of blocks whose memory
has been released."

So I made the same changes in this document.
